Global Standards Compliance
LIB chambers are built to meet or exceed leading test specifications worldwide, ensuring every data set is certification-ready:

IEC 60068: Environmental testing for electrical and electronic equipment

ISO 16750: Environmental requirements for road-vehicle electronics

IEC 61730: Photovoltaic module safety and weathering tests

ASTM D2247 / D1735: Moisture-resistance for coatings, plastics, and assemblies

ICH Q1A (R2), Q1B: Pharmaceutical stability protocols

ISO 11452 / ISO 7637: Automotive EMC and transient immunity

 

Test Precision & Repeatability

Wide Climate Envelope: –70 °C to +150 °C, 20–98 % RH

Tight Stability: ± 0.5 °C temperature fluctuation, ± 2.5 % RH humidity deviation

Rapid Cycling: 3 °C/min heating, 1 °C/min cooling (average, unloaded)

High-Accuracy Sensing: PT100 Class A sensors with ± 0.001 °C resolution; chilled-mirror humidity measurement for continuous feedback

Uniformity Guaranteed: Multi-directional centrifugal fans and precision airflow baffles maintain < 1.5 °C gradient across all points in the chamber volume.

The LIB Temperature and Humidity Test Chamber Upgraded Design Incorporates Vibration, CO₂ Control, and RF Shielding

Real-world reliability often demands more than climate alone. Electronics must endure RF interference, materials must survive corrosive gases, and mechanical assemblies must pass shock and vibration profiles. LIB integrates these complexities into one modular platform:

 

Integrated Vibration Testing

Purpose: Combine thermal cycling with mechanical shock to uncover latent failures early

Capability: IEC 60068-2-6 (sinusoidal vibration) and IEC 60068-2-27 (shock) profiles

Result: A single workflow that evaluates solder joint fatigue, connector stability, and structural integrity under simultaneous thermal and mechanical load

CO₂ Climatic Control

Range: 0–20 % CO₂ concentration, ± 0.4 % accuracy via infrared sensors and precision valves

Use Cases:

Corrosion Studies (ISO 187, ASTM D2247): Simulate greenhouse or industrial emissions on coatings, metals, and polymers

Agricultural & Biological Testing: Controlled CO₂ for seed germination, tissue culture, or microbial studies under defined TH profiles

Electronics Reliability: Evaluate circuit corrosion, solder degradation, and battery gassing in high-CO₂ atmospheres
